SACRAMENTO – Governor Edmund G. Brown Jr. today announced the following appointments.

Susan Johnson, 67, of Rescue, has been appointed to the California Private Security Disciplinary Review Committee, North. Johnson was principal and owner of Tallent Johnson Consulting from 2001 to 2011 and an independent residential sales agent at Leu Enterprises and at Keller Williams Realty from 2005 to 2010. She was an independent residential mortgage loan agent at Residential Mortgage Lending from 2001 to 2005 and a vice president banking center manager at Bank of America from 1974 to 2000. This position does not require Senate confirmation and the compensation is $100 per diem. Johnson is a Republican.

Dan Presser, 71, of Monterey, has been appointed to the 7th District Agricultural Association, Monterey County Fair Board of Directors. Presser has been owner at Four Winds Travel since 1994. He was a travel agent at Ashely Travel from 1992 to 1993 and a public relations director at Mazda Raceway Laguna Seca in 1991. He is a member of the Association of Retail Travel Agents, the American Legion, Post 41 Board, Monterey County Military and Veterans Affairs Advisory Commission and the Carmel Chamber of Commerce. This position does not require Senate confirmation and there is no compensation. Presser is a Democrat.

Marshall Miller, 36, of Santa Barbara, has been reappointed to the 19th District Agricultural Association, Santa Barbara County Fair and Exposition Board of Directors, where he has served since 2012. Miller has been vice president of finance and operations at the ThornHill Companies since 2010. He was an assistant vice president at CTC Consulting from 2002 to 2005 and assistant controller at Nicholas Bagshaw Company from 2000 to 2002. He is a member of the American Vineyard Foundation. This position does not require Senate confirmation and there is no compensation. Miller is a Republican.
